Transaction 0864e66e389be4a1d56cd7a7b0188886e01d1c5f37841304952a583ef767a11a

1 Input
2 Outputs
  • 0864e66e389be4a1d56cd7a7b0188886e01d1c5f37841304952a583ef767a11a:0
  • value  1768564
    address  1ArG3JwEbF4WrCiEnXQXUAgQumAVzqnQHD
  • 0864e66e389be4a1d56cd7a7b0188886e01d1c5f37841304952a583ef767a11a:1
  • value  37433108
    address  32NE5Z9KUkfd6qKbmLg2Qie1doZ6PCBi8P